Which role pays more on average: Generative AI Engineer or Quantitative Researcher?
In Australia, Quantitative Researcher roles typically command a higher median salary than Generative AI Engineer positions. According to our 2026 live benchmark data, a mid-level Quantitative Researcher earns a median salary of A$149K, whereas a Generative AI Engineer brings in roughly A$140K (a gap of A$9K at the median).
This difference narrows and widens depending on tech stack and location. Roles based in major hubs like Australia typically pay a 15–25% premium to offset local cost-of-living pressures. Fully remote positions across Australia tend to compress toward the national median. Senior practitioners in either discipline can exceed the upper range through specialist skills.
